In each question two equations numbered I and II are given,you haveto solve both the equation and choose the correctanswer.

I. 5x2+ 28x = -15II. 3y2+ 11y + 6 = 0

A) X > Y B) X ≥ Y
C) X < Y D) X ≤ Y
 
Answer & Explanation Answer:

Explanation:

5x^2+ 28x = -15x = (-3/5, -5)

II. 3y^2+ 11y + 6 = 0y = (-3, -2/3)

So Relationship cannot be established
